Key Considerations Before Choosing a Name

Naming your beauty bar is a blend of creativity and strategy. Before you start brainstorming, consider these foundational elements to ensure your name aligns with your business goals and vision.

1. Define Your Brand Identity

Your name should be a reflection of your brand’s personality, values, and mission. Ask yourself:

  • What is the core philosophy of my beauty bar? (e.g., sustainability, luxury, innovation, affordability)
  • Who is my target audience? (e.g., millennials, professionals, brides, men)
  • What is the desired client experience? (e.g., relaxing, efficient, transformative)

For instance, if your bar focuses on organic and natural treatments, a name like “Eden Glow Bar” or “Pure Bloom Beauty” might be fitting. If you’re targeting a high-end clientele, consider names that evoke luxury, such as “Opulence Lounge” or “La Belle Époque.”

2. Keep It Memorable and Easy to Pronounce

A name that is difficult to spell or say can hinder word-of-mouth referrals and online searches. Aim for simplicity and clarity. Names like “Glow Bar,” “Skin Sanctum,” or “The Polish Room” are straightforward yet distinctive. Avoid overly complex or obscure words that might confuse potential clients.

3. Ensure Availability and Legality

Before falling in love with a name, conduct thorough checks to ensure it’s available for use. This includes:

  • Domain Availability: Check if the corresponding website domain (e.g., .com, .co.uk) is available.
  • Social Media Handles: Secure consistent usernames across platforms like Instagram, Facebook, and TikTok.
  • Trademark Search: Verify that the name isn’t already trademarked to avoid legal issues.
  • Local Business Registries: Ensure no other business in your area is using the same or a similar name.

4. Think Long-Term and Scalable

Choose a name that allows for future growth. If you plan to expand your services or locations, avoid names that are too narrow or geographically specific. For example, “Downtown Nail Studio” might limit you if you decide to open a second location in the suburbs. Instead, opt for something more versatile like “Canvas Beauty Bar” or “Aura Studio.”

5. Consider SEO and Online Visibility

In today’s digital age, your beauty bar’s online presence is crucial. Incorporating relevant keywords into your name can boost your search engine rankings. For example, including words like “beauty,” “glow,” “skin,” or “bar” can help potential clients find you more easily. However, balance this with creativity—avoid generic names like “Best Beauty Bar” that lack personality.

Practical Steps to Brainstorm and Finalize Your Name

Now that you have a sense of the possibilities, follow these steps to generate and refine your beauty bar’s name.

Step 1: Gather Your Team and Brainstorm

Involve key stakeholders—whether it’s your business partners, employees, or trusted friends—in a brainstorming session. Encourage free thinking and write down every idea, no matter how unconventional. Use prompts like:

  • Words associated with beauty, glow, radiance, care.
  • Terms that reflect your location or community.
  • Metaphors related to transformation, art, or science.

Step 2: Shortlist and Evaluate

Narrow down your list to 5-10 favorites. Evaluate each based on the criteria discussed earlier: memorability, relevance, availability, and scalability. Say the names out loud, imagine them on a sign, and consider how they might look in a logo.

Step 3: Test with Your Target Audience

Get feedback from potential clients or your existing network. Create a simple survey or poll on social media to see which names resonate most. Pay attention to their associations and emotions evoked by each option.

Step 4: Check Legal and Digital Availability

Once you have a frontrunner, conduct thorough checks for domain availability, social media handles, and trademarks. If your preferred name is taken, consider variations or synonyms.

Step 5: Make the Final Decision

Trust your instincts while considering the feedback and practicalities. Choose a name that you love, that aligns with your vision, and that you can envision growing with your business.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

Even with the best intentions, it’s easy to make mistakes when naming your beauty bar. Here are some common pitfalls and how to steer clear of them.

  • Being Too Trendy: While it’s tempting to jump on the latest buzzword, trends fade. Choose a name with timeless appeal.
  • Overcomplicating: Avoid long, hyphenated, or hard-to-spell names that might confuse clients.
  • Limiting Your Scope: Names like “Lash Lab” might restrict you if you decide to offer facials or other services later.
  • Ignoring Cultural Sensitivity: Ensure your name doesn’t unintentionally offend or misrepresent any culture or group.
